Protective hairstyles for rolling and comps? by BritishBrownActor in bjj

[–]BTheSage 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I’ve got very long locs. During training I’ll do the compression scarves or a durag with another hair tie wrapped at the end. For camps and competition I do shortened braids and just cover my scalp

K/X/SLX Guard by CardiK289 in bjj

[–]BTheSage 7 points8 points  (0 children)

My humble opinion: Lachlan’s K Guard Anthology will give you a fire hydrant’s worth of context to retain and effectively threaten from K Guard. I’ve paired that with Neil Melanson’s K Control which emphasizes playing the dilemma between attacking the top and legs. Jason Scully also has a great video on YouTube providing techniques from K Guard

Question for people with Black/African hair. by limeonysnicket in bjj

[–]BTheSage 2 points3 points  (0 children)

I’ve got really long locs. To protect whatever style I have in or myself from having to get a retwist every week I do either a full bonnet that ties or a durag + a tube cap
